The Panasonic PV-V4621 four-head hi-fi stereo VCR is home theater ready with convenient front audio-video jacks. This sleek, silver VCR offers a host of convenient features including the VCR Plus+ Silver program guide with ZIP code setup, Movie and Commercial Advance, tape-position display, and index and program-end search options.

The PV-V4621's four-head design delivers a dramatically crisp, clear picture to your television. Its pair of RCA audio jacks coupled with its hi-fi design offer enhanced audio output, making this a great VCR to connect to your home theater system.

In addition to its superb audio and video output, Panasonic includes VCR Plus+ Silver program guide, which lets you program most recordings simply by entering your ZIP code, taking much of the hassle out of the process. The PV-V4621's Movie and Commercial advance zips you past movie previews and commercials. Index search lets you quickly and precisely index and then search for your favorite recordings using discrete numeric codes, while program-end search takes you to the end of a program at the touch of a button.

The onscreen tape-position display shows you the tape's current position in the recording process. Other displays include multilingual onscreen displays that let you read programming guides and menus in English, Spanish, or French.

Panasonic's PV-V4621 also includes all those features you've come to expect with a VCR--pause, resume play, one-touch recording, auto stop, and more. An illuminated multibrand universal remote control is also included.

The PV-V4621 is Energy Star compliant and comes with a warranty of a year on parts, 90 days on labor.

I had to stop using SP recording & use only LP or SLP as SP became too grainy after a couple of months. This makes a lot of noise on rewind! The remote has buttons not compatible with multiremotes. The some remote buttons are tiny-- as people have said. Its a pretty cheap vcr now & its the only one I could find with commercial advance other than the go video vcr which is a lot more. Programming it is a drag because you have to hit up/down every time for each minute or hour. I suppose mind needs a cleaning, which I can do to get recording back in SP speed. Fair enough, but there is nothing I can do about the noise on rewind. The buttons on front are larger than usual. The front lcd display shows more than just nbrs, it shows PLAY, REC, etc so you know what its doing., But if you hear a loud whirrrrrrrrr youll know its rewinding without looking at the display. It's not compatible with my Guide Plus feature either, grrrrrrrr!.....

After reading the reviews posted here I see that Panasonic must have a serious quality control issue with these units. Mine arrived last week and was easy enough to set up. I didn't record anything for a few days. I recorded a show last Sunday night and could not believe my eyes/ears when I played the tape back. There are some serious tracking issues. Snow all over the screen and a flat, hum-laden audio signal were all I could get out of playback. I spent hours testing verious settings, connections, etc. with the same result each time. I'm returning this VCR pronto and looking at reviews more closely next time.

This VCR has many fine bells and whistles--"features," they call them. I was glad it had them. It was also fairly easy to install and set up. But I was greatly disappointed with the quality of the picture. At first I thought the poor picture quality might be due to poor tapes, so I tried a variety of tapes, from brand-new commercially manufactured tapes to older (fine) tapes I'd made off the TV. All tapes appeared grainy, with poor color saturation. The reds and dark browns were especially bad. My old VCR, also a Panasonic, which I have used for over 10 years, produced a far better picture from all tapes, new and old. I very rarely return a product to the seller, but in this case I felt bound to. I knew that if I kept it and continued to use it, I would feel nothing but irritation and frustration with the inferior picture quality.

I love the features of this VCR, especialy the automatic commercial advance. The VCR marks the beginning and end of commercials and then automatically fast forwards through them on playback. A time-shifter's dream! I previously reviewed this as 3 stars because it was incompatible with my new Panasonic HDTV set. I found out that the TV was the problem, not the VCR. Now that I have hooked it up to my Sony XBR HDTV, I am very pleased with my purchase.
